Output 3412145801d1c6e473d202f57659b84d148b5ec1ae7c1b7f25d6cee7697b6cfe:1

value
1889550
script pubkey
OP_0 OP_PUSHBYTES_20 95c89680605f7e587bc3c6e572038ae1cb55f7fb
address
bc1qjhyfdqrqtal9s77rcmjhyqu2u894talm0lhjaz
transaction
3412145801d1c6e473d202f57659b84d148b5ec1ae7c1b7f25d6cee7697b6cfe
spent
true